On 19-Jan-96 00:00:42, Robert Cohen (rcohen@monmouth.com) Emailed:
> I have recently reinstalled my TBCIV software on my Amiga and could not
> get the board to respond to it... I know that this is something dumb
> that I have overlooked, since I recall being stumped with this one years
> ago when I first popped it in, but I have combed both the par manual and
> this one, and I am just overlooking it...
You need to set the jumper on the TBC-IV to use 9600 baud, and in the TBC
software, set the "serial port" setting to PAR and 9600 baud.
